If you are behind on your mortgage before submitting your Chapter thirteen, it is possible to pay back the arrears via your repayment strategy. If Anytime throughout your Chapter thirteen scenario, you are unsuccessful to pay your regular monthly mortgage obligation , your lender can request court docket authorization to foreclose on your own home.
